Opposition MPs in India's Rajya Sabha raised concerns about US President Donald Trump's tariff threats, demanding the government clarify its response and engage in discussions with opposition parties. Leaders like P Chidambaram and Sagarika Ghose warned of potential economic repercussions, including depressed exports, lower FDI, and a significant tariff burden. The debate also touched on other issues such as the government's economic policies, demonetization, and the impact of GST on common citizens.

Over 70 companies of paramilitary forces and more than 15,000 police personnel will be deployed across the national capital for Republic Day celebrations, an official said. The city will be monitored by drones and CCTV surveillance, and cyber-specialist officers will be deployed to oversee operations. Multi-layered security arrangements, including six layers of checking and frisking, barricading, and thousands of CCTV cameras with Facial Recognition Systems (FRS), will be in place.

Richard Verma, the highest-ranking Indian-American official in the State Department, has expressed optimism about the future of US-India ties and emphasized the need to base the relationship on shared values rather than mere transactional dealings. Verma, who previously served as America's Ambassador to India, stressed the importance of the Quad in defending the international order, highlighting its shared commitment to a free and open Indo-Pacific.

The 76th Republic Day Parade concluded with a memorable display of aerial acrobatics, including a stunning victory roll by Rafale aircraft and daring maneuvers by Sukhoi-30 fighter jets. The flypast, featuring over 40 aircraft, captivated the large crowd gathered along Kartavya Path, including President Droupadi Murmu, Indonesian President Prabowo Subianto, and Prime Minister Narendra Modi. The parade showcased the strength and skill of the Indian Air Force and provided a spectacular visual experience for the audience.
